Transaction 58e368ac95afa4ddf86f3051b66246a250648f198df45f3d806c218dea95bf74
1 Input
1 Output
-
58e368ac95afa4ddf86f3051b66246a250648f198df45f3d806c218dea95bf74:0
- value
- 229992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bce82333b16307c3ebafa18c3077ebc7b47bdfe OP_EQUAL
- address
- 3LGeUxHWh96WiF3RS3xgT726231HbJscEU